What Are French Doors?
French doors are generally made up of 2 hinged panels, opening outward or inward, with glass panes that extend the full length of each door. Stemming in the Renaissance period, these doors were designed to enhance light and presence in between areas, frequently causing outdoor patios, gardens, or terraces.
Key Features of French Doors
- Full-length Glass Panels: These permit optimal light projection into the interior and deal gorgeous views of the environments.
- Versatile Opening Styles: Depending on design choice, French doors can be set up to swing open from the center or be set up versus a wall.
- Range of Materials: Common products include wood, fiberglass, and vinyl, each offering special benefits in regards to aesthetic appeals and upkeep.
Side Windows: The Perfect Companion
Side windows, often referred to as "sidelights," are narrow windows placed on either side of a door, often seen in conjunction with French doors. These windows even more boost the entrance, providing additional light and presence.

Upkeep Tips for French Doors and Side Windows
Preserving French doors and side windows is essential to guaranteeing their durability and aesthetic appeal. Here are some t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Use warm, soapy water to wipe down the glass and frames, avoiding extreme chemicals that can damage finishes.
- Inspect Seals: Periodically examine for weather stripping wear or damages that could cause drafts.
- Check Hardware: Ensure that hinges, deals with, and locks are operating correctly and lubricate them as needed.
- Repaint or Stain: Wood doors may require periodic refinishing to protect versus weathering and preserve their appearance.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
What are the typical measurements of French doors and side windows?
French doors normally vary from 60 to 72 inches in width and 80 inches in height. Side windows are generally narrower, often about 12 to 18 inches.
Can French doors be utilized as interior doors?
Yes, French doors can be an exceptional option for interior areas, providing light transmission in between rooms while offering a sense of separateness.
Are there any specific building regulations for French doors and side windows?
Building regulations can vary by location, so it is important to check regional policies regarding setup and safety standards.
How can I boost the security of my French doors?
Think about setting up multi-point locking systems or including security film to the glass. Enhancing door frames can also enhance security.
